Recognizing Typical Home Appliance Issues



When your appliances begin breaking down, it can really feel overwhelming, especially if you're uncertain what the trouble is. Usual problems typically occur with refrigerators, washing machines, and clothes dryers, and recognizing what to try to find can conserve you time and tension. As an example, if your refrigerator isn't cooling down, inspect the temperature settings or pay attention for unusual noises that might indicate a falling short compressor.With cleaning machines, leaks typically come from used tubes or defective door seals. If your clothes dryer isn't heating, a clogged air vent could be the offender.

Source Of Power Precautions



Making certain that a device is detached from its source of power is vital for your security during fixings (Washer dryer repair service Dependable Refrigeration). Prior to you begin, disconnect the device or turn off the circuit breaker. This easy step stops electric shocks or mishaps. Always verify that the power is off utilizing a voltage tester-- do not depend on assumptions! If you're dealing with larger appliances, take into consideration using a lockout/tagout system to stop unintended awakening. Keep your job area dry and clear of mess to decrease threats. Use protected gloves and use devices with rubber grasps to supply additional protection. Never effort fixings in wet conditions, as water and electricity do not mix. By following these preventative measures, you'll develop a much safer environment for your do it yourself repair service job

Maintaining Your Home Appliances for Long life



To guarantee your home appliances offer you well for years to find, normal maintenance is essential. Begin by cleansing your appliances on a regular basis; dirt and debris can develop and prevent efficiency. For fridges, check the door seals and clean the coils to maintain them efficient. Laundry your cleaning machine's drum and dispensers to avoid my response mold and mildew and odors.Don' t forget to examine tubes and connections for leaks or use. For dish washers, run a cleaning cycle regular monthly to confirm correct water drainage and remove odors.Keep an eye on any unusual noises or performance issues-- dealing with these early can stop expensive fixings down the line (Kenmore Dryer Repair Oro Valley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service). Lastly, refer to your appliance manuals for specific upkeep tips and recommended solution periods. By adopting these techniques, you'll not just prolong the life of your appliances yet likewise enhance their performance, conserving you time and money in the lengthy run
